FreePrints photo printing service comes to Windows Phone 8

Cal Morell FreePrints Windows Phone at Casual Connect

Casual Connect is an event dedicated to casual videogames, but you?ll often run into more than just game developers and PR people. One such attendee was Cal Morrell of Avenquest Software and Photo Affections. They?ve created a remarkable photo printing app for Windows Phone 8 that photography fans (especially Lumia 1020 owners) are going to love called FreePrints.

We sat down with Cal, who walked us through FreePrints? features and the process of optimizing the app for Windows Phone 8. Note that this app is currently available only in the United States, but we do have good news for international users (and our hands on video footage) after the break!

From your phone to reality

FreePrints is a free Windows Phone 8 app that allows you to select photographs from a variety of sources and then have them professionally printed and shipped to your door.

The first time you use the app you?ll go through a quick tutorial that explains how the app works. Then it?s time to set up your account and start linking your various picture hosting accounts to the app.

FreePrints can edit and print images from a wide variety of sources:

  • Your Windows Phone
  • Dropbox
  • Facebook
  • Flickr
  • Instagram
  • Picasa
  • SkyDrive

The beautiful thing about this app is that you can combine images from all of those places into a single order. Just select the photos you want from a source, press Back on your phone, and then select another source to keep adding pictures to the order. Wherever you are in the app, you?ll see the total number of pictures in your shopping cart at the top-right corner of the screen.

Ordering process

FreePrints for Windows Phone 8

After choosing the pictures you?d like to have printed, FreePrints gives you the option to crop and rotate the individual images. Users can select from numerous print sizes: 4 x 6 inches, 5 x 5 (Instagram ratio), 8 x 10, and many more, all the way up to 20 x 30.

Once you?ve got your order lined up, you can choose between standard shipping (5-13 days) and expedited (4-6 days). The FreePrints app accepts credit cards and PayPal as payment.

Your photographs will arrive by mail shortly thereafter. Photo Affections is a reputable printing service and the pictures they deliver will be of the highest quality, not the rush jobs you?d get from a one-hour printing place. They won?t fade and will last for years when stored in an acid-free album.

Free prints for a year!

FreePrints for Windows Phone 8

To promote the FreePrints service, all users get 85 free 4 x 6 prints per month.? Your free prints must be unique ? you can?t print the same image twice for free. You?ll only pay for shipping, and the FreePrints shipping prices are actually lower than what Photo Affections charges on their website.

Canada draws up directive on beacons in 787 fire investigation


Sat Aug 3, 2013 3:27pm EDT

(Reuters) - Canada's air transport regulator is drawing up a safety directive concerning the emergency beacons at the center of an investigation into a fire on a parked Boeing 787 Dreamliner last month, it said on Saturday.

The directive - which would list action that airlines or manufacturers must take - will take into account inspections done by manufacturer Honeywell International and its Canadian sub-contractor Instrumar Ltd, Transport Canada said in a statement.

"Transport Canada is developing an airworthiness directive in consultation with the FAA (U.S. Federal Aviation Administration) and EASA (European Aviation Safety Agency)," the statement said.

"The airworthiness directive would be based on the information collected from the equipment inspections mandated by the FAA, information already provided by Honeywell, and the results of (Transport Canada's) inspections of Honeywell and Instrumar."

Emergency Locator Transmitters - designed to help locate an aircraft in the event of a crash - marketed by Honeywell have emerged as a key focus of the investigation into a blaze which caused serious damage to a parked 787 jet owned by Ethiopian Airlines at London's Heathrow airport on July 12.

The FAA has ordered inspections on the beacons in 787s, and Boeing last week expanded the inspections to cover more than 1,000 aircraft of all types that are fitted with the devices.

The Wall Street Journal reported that the Canadian directive would expand inspections to cover all types of planes that use the suspect emergency transmitters, including jets from Boeing, Europe's Airbus and Dassault Aviation.

Although the 787 is designed and manufactured in the United States, Transport Canada is the lead safety agency on the beacons, which are manufactured in Newfoundland.

An earlier model of Honeywell beacon faced scrutiny from Canada's regulator in a previous airworthiness directive in 2009.

It called for suspect parts to be modified or replaced after tests found that two units were unable to broadcast the emergency homing signal on the right frequency.

Oil patch city wants to be known as 'Boomtown USA'

WILLISTON, N.D. (AP) ? The city in the heart of western North Dakota's booming oil patch has a new brand ? "Boomtown USA."

The Williston Convention and Visitor's Bureau unveiled the theme on Thursday.

"As our community is expanding and becoming unlike anything it has ever been before, the Williston CVB must also grow and boldly embrace who we are, what we stand for and truly define our own future," said Amy Krueger, the bureau's executive director.

"This new direction does all that and more as it defines Williston in the eyes of tourists and visitors and lays a foundation for the family fun, historic and outdoor aspects of life in Williston," she said.

The city has some of its earliest roots as a boomtown, when the fur trading business exploded in 1828. That also is the year when Fort Union opened its doors. It was a fur-trading post along the Missouri River in northwestern North Dakota for much of the 19th century, and now is a national historic site.

The oil boom and its promise of jobs has drawn people from around the country to Williston. The U.S. Census bureau estimates that the city's population has grown from 14,700 in 2010 to 26,700, and a city-sponsored study done by North Dakota State University concluded that the number could be as high as 33,000.

The NDSU study also concluded that Williston's population could reach 44,000 by 2017.

The Census Bureau says Williston is the fastest-growing area with a population of 10,000 to 49,999 residents in the U.S.

Controversial Golf Project in Croatia's Dubrovnik Cleared by Authorities


Critics have raised environmental concerns over the development on a site, and also said that the modern project is incompatible with the architecture of the city, a UNESCO world heritage site.

The project, backed by Australian former world number one golfer Greg Norman, aims to build two golf courses, two hotels, 240 villas and 400 apartments on 310 hectares (766 acres) of the land.

"A total of 16 city councillors of the 24 present during Tuesday's vote backed the project," city council spokeswoman Kristina Civalo told AFP of the vote on Tuesday evening.

Construction on the project -- the brainchild of Israeli businessman Aaron Frenkel -- could begin later this year.

Those supporting the scheme say it will result in the creation of local jobs and provide a boost to the tourism industry.

Norman, who won two Majors, is to open a golf academy at the project site, local media reported.

Some 100 protestors had gathered outside Dubrovnik's city hall to voice their opposition and carried banners which read "Srdj is ours" in reference to the name of the land where the complex will be built.

The newest member of the European Union, Croatia hosts more than 11 million tourists yearly, almost triple of its population of 4.2 million.

Dubrovnik is visited by some 700,000 tourists every year.

Real Estate Down Slightly During The Second Quarter | Marotta On ...

Real Estate during 2Q 2013

Real Estate Stocks are an important part of the category of Resource Stocks, sometimes called ?Hard Asset? Stocks. They were down slightly in the second quarter of 2013. Foreign real estate was down more for the quarter because the U.S. Dollar strengthened against foreign currencies.

  • Vanguard REIT ETF (VNQ) was down 1.6% during the second quarter, but still up 9.08% for the past year and still averaging 8.11% for the last 5 years.
  • Vanguard Global ex-U.S. Real Estate ETF (VNQI) was down 6.72% during the second quarter, but still averaging 18.29% for the past year.

We still recommend a healthy allocation to publicly traded real estate investment trusts.
